Tripiti Chania: One of the most secluded beaches in Crete, Tripiti is located close to the tourist village of Sougia and at the end of Tripiti Gorge. Accessed on foot, by boat or through a track road, this beach is not organized and no tourist facilities in close distance. About 70 km south of Chania Town, this beach is worth a visit for its unspoilt beauty and crystalline waters. It is one of the places that is much preferred by the nature lovers. The closest facilities and accommodation are found in Sougia, Paleochora and Agia Roumeli. Tripiti has soft sand and clean water. The surrounding nature is wild and provides the perfect setting for total privacy.

Tripiti is a 400m long beach on the southern Asterousia coastline.The beach took its name after the church of Panagia Tripiti which is built inside a cave at the base of the gorge.A quiet beach,covered with fine pebbles and sand and clean dark green waters.The rocks around Trypiti are full of small caverns(holes)thus the name Trypiti which means the one with the holes.Near the beach there are a few tamarisk trees several meters away from the shore, under which you can camp.Tripití is very popular with locals and in the hot summer weekends it can be overcrowded. Especially in August,it gathers quite a lot people for such a secluded beach.Unlike other coastal places there are only a few buildings,mostly huts since the area belongs to the Natura network and there are restrictions in the use of land .There are however a lot of caravans that seem to be there on a permanent basis.Of course camping is prohibited and only one caravan can be hosted in each land property! Anyway there is plenty of room even in the shade of the tamarisks and the sea is very nice.There are two taverns but no umbrellas and sunbeds.
